Rubber gaskets are essential sealing components designed to prevent leaks between two surfaces under compression. Utilized across various industries, they offer flexibility, durability, and resistance to diverse environmental conditions. Available in forms like sheets, O-rings, and custom shapes, rubber gaskets are tailored to meet specific application requirements.

Materials

Rubber gaskets are manufactured from various elastomers, each offering distinct properties

  • E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er): Excellent resistance to weathering, ozone, and UV exposure; suitable for outdoor applications.

  • Neoprene: Offers good chemical stability and maintains flexibility over a wide temperature range.

  • Nitrile (Buna-N): Ideal for applications involving oils and fuels due to its superior oil resistance.

  • Silicone: Performs well in extreme temperatures; often used in food-grade applications.

  • Viton (FKM): High-performance material resistant to heat, chemicals, and oils.

Applications

Rubber gaskets are integral to numerous industries:​

  • Automotive: Sealing engine components, transmissions, and exhaust systems.

  • Aerospace: Used in fuel systems, hydraulic systems, and cabin pressure controls.

  • Oil and Gas: Sealing pipelines, valves, and pumps to prevent hazardous leaks.

  • Food Processing: Ensuring sanitary seals in mixers, pumps, and pipelines.

  • Construction: Sealing joints in buildings, bridges, and other structures.
